 multimedia arts bearing witness to Pandacan. \n\nMore than 84,000 Filipinos 
 live in Pandacan, the heart of Metro Manila. Families, students and 
 businesses live in the vicinity of Pandacan's massive oil depots and face 
 daily threats to their health and safety. Yet Pandacan is more than a toxic 
 site - it is the proud birthplace of Filipino opera, balagtasan poetry, 
 national revolutionaries, and communities' struggles for 
 justice.\n\nFeaturing live zarzuela music, testimonials from FACES
